Abstract

Objective: Managing anxiety, fear and pain are critical components of any dental procedure. The current study quantitatively assessed the variations in salivary cortisol levels associated with stress triggered by three common dental treatments, such as teeth whitening, veneer preparation, and dental implant placement.


Aim: This In Vivo study aimed to assess and comparatively evaluate the variations in salivary cortisol levels associated with stress across patients undergoing teeth whitening, veneer preparation for fixed prostheses, and dental implant placement.


Methods: The levels of salivary cortisol were assessed in 80 individuals, comprising 40 healthy individuals (control) and 40 patients who underwent treatment (teeth whitening, veneer preparation, or dental implants). The patients were divided into four groups. To determine concentrations of cortisol in saliva, an Enzyme Immunoassay Kit was utilised in accordance with the manufacturer's protocol.


Saliva samples from each group underwent cortisol analysis via a validated Enzyme Immunoassay procedure calibrated specifically for salivary hormone quantification.


Results: The data revealed a stepwise reduction in salivary cortisol from Group 4 — which showed hormone levels — through Group 2 and Group 3, to Group 1, which showed minimal cortisol activity, implying that procedural invasiveness is a key determinant of the magnitude of stress in dental patients.


Conclusion: Patients who underwent implant placement showed the highest physiological stress response among all the procedures administered in the current study. Even a non-invasive procedure like teeth whitening showed a measurable elevation in the levels of cortisol, highlighting the necessity of assessing anxiety on a routine basis and management across all types of dental treatments.
